Around 20 people were injured, including four in serious or critical condition, after an Iranian ballistic missile struck the city of Beit Shemesh in Israel, the Times of Israel reported, citing emergency services.
The Magen David Adom emergency service said 17 injured people were transported to hospitals, including two in serious condition, one with moderate injuries and 14 in good condition.
Among those seriously wounded is a 10-year-old girl.
Two others remain at the scene in critical condition.
